CC - zero clearance and 4GT turbos are two completely different approaches to get more HP.
The Zero clearance is Kevin's design and uses a K16/K24 hybrid then coats the inside such as to reduce clearance and thus imprve spool time and efficiency....
The 4GT turbos last I checked use a garrett ball bearing impeller in a custom K24 housing.
